Nobody really knows what you’re wearing

Posted by Robin on 6 January 2020 5 Comments

Nobody really knows what you're wearing. You're not walking around with, like, a Gucci belt or a Dior bag or something that people can see. So actually, I think one of the great things about perfume is that it is about self-creation and self-performance.

— Read more in Rachel Syme On 'Perfume Genie' at NPR.
